1. Free Press Summer Fest

Annual music festival in Houston featuring a variety of artists from different genres. Offers food trucks and activities.
  • Diverse Lineup: Features a wide range of music genres including rock, pop, hip-hop, electronic, and indie.
  • Community Engagement: Supports local charities and non-profits through ticket sales and community engagement initiatives.
  • Food Truck Haven: Brings together a variety of popular Houston food trucks for festival-goers to enjoy.

2. Day For Night Festival

Art and music festival combining large-scale installation art pieces with performances by renowned musicians.
  • Interactive Art: Offers immersive and interactive art installations that change throughout the festival.
  • Unusual Location: Takes place at an industrial site, providing a unique and edgy atmosphere.
  • Cutting-Edge Performances: Brings together experimental artists in music, art, and technology for innovative performances.

3.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o

Annual event featuring live music concerts, livestock shows, and rodeo competitions.
  • Big-name Concerts: Hosts popular country musicians as well as artists from other genres.
  • Cultural Education: Educates visitors about agriculture, livestock, and rural life through exhibits and competitions.
  • Rodeo Events: Showcases rodeo events like bull riding, team roping, and barrel racing.

6. Houston Greek Festival

Celebration of Greek culture with food, dance, and music.
  • Authentic Greek Food: Offers traditional Greek dishes like moussaka, gyro, and baklava.
  • Live Greek Music and Dance: Features live performances of traditional Greek music and dance.
  • Learning Opportunities: Provides educational opportunities about Greek history, art, and traditions.
